Output 62be8b53d13aa2d62c9fb4f92c9a49ec36873d3fff689826b37e7bac907f4761:0

value
3098790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3dc6d64ccb8f3f70a820cf58422864cb4ee242c OP_EQUAL
address
3KYdkWVeYwf3XVNaaVH5jJAGFHrnbf2v36
transaction
62be8b53d13aa2d62c9fb4f92c9a49ec36873d3fff689826b37e7bac907f4761
confirmations
374121
spent
true